The Light of Officialdom

by 狂草劲风

He came from a muddy village road without streetlights, and spent twenty years walking into the city's myriad lights. Lin Zhou, at twenty-two, was the first college student in his village. His ancestors were farmers, his family destitute. He gave up a city job to return home and take the civil service exam. On his first day reporting for duty, he was publicly humiliated: "From a poor mountain valley, don't stand out." He lived in a moldy dormitory with peeling walls and took on hot potatoes no one dared touch. When a mountain flood broke out, he was the first to jump into the floodwaters. During a road construction project, someone slapped 80,000 yuan in cash on his desk. From mediating a 30-centimeter land dispute between two families to making decisions for the development of millions in a city—he spent twenty years. Some advised him to pick sides, some forced him to compromise, some threatened his childhood friend's business to make him yield. His answer was only one sentence: "I am a son of farmers; I stand with the people." An ordinary man, without background, without backing, without a golden finger, relying solely on an unyielding heart and feet covered in mud, he rose from a township clerk to mayor. Starting from the mud, never betraying the people. For an official, the ultimate destination is the myriad lights of the city.
